Cheesy and Seasoned Onion Frittata

Serves 4 | 
A great breakfast begins with the ingredients.

Ingredients:

1 cup onion, thinly sliced
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 cup Parmesan cheese, finely grated
1/3 cup Ricotta cheese
1 tomato, sliced
8 eggs
3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 teaspoon rosemary, minced
1/8 teaspoon ground black pepper
3 basil leaves, torn to pieces

Directions:

  1. Combine Basil, salt, Parmesan, eggs, ground pepper and rosemary in a mixing bowl. Stir together until evenly mixed.
  2. Pour olive oil into a skillet, set heat to medium-high. After heated, sauté onion for 6 minutes.
  3. Reduce the heat to low and pour in eggs mixture. Stir the ingredients together.
  4. Scoop a small amount of ricotta into the skillet, keep adding until gone.
  5. Cook the skillet ingredients for 2 minutes, letting them set. Add tomatoes to the skillet and gently stir. Pour ingredients into a baking dish and bake 7-9 minutes.
  6. Remove from oven and place on serving try, cut into small wedges and serve!
Course: Breakfast, lunch, dinner, snack
